Essential Tools for a Successful Dog Training Journey
Every dedicated dog owner desires a well-trained companion. Achieving this goal requires more than just understanding; it demands the right supplies. To embark on your dog training journey with confidence, equip yourself with these essential items.
- High-Quality Leash and Collar: A sturdy leash and collar are fundamental for control and safety during walks and training sessions. Choose a adjustable option that fits your dog properly.
- Tasty Treats: Positive reinforcement is the cornerstone of successful dog training. Stock up on small, fragrant treats that your dog loves to reward desired behaviors.
- Clicker: A clicker provides a clear and instantaneous signal to mark desired actions. Combine it with verbal cues for effective communication.
- Interactive Games: Keeping your dog mentally stimulated is crucial for their well-being and training progress. Invest in interactive toys or puzzles that encourage problem-solving and fun
